Release Notes

main

Feb. 20, 2024 don la dieu (nega at icecube.umd.edu)

IceTray Release v1.9.2

  • Delete mailinglist files (#3357)

  • Add upgrade rules to ruff (#3316)

  • add ruff rule PLW0602 global-variable-not-assigned (#3331)

  • Remove all tab characters used for indentation from python files (#3300)

Dec. 14, 2023 don la dieu (nega at icecube.umd.edu)

IceTray Release v1.9.0

  • Remove Uber Header (I3.h) (#3151)

  • general python cleanups (ruff/E713) (#3269)

June 22, 2023 don la dieu (nega at icecube.umd.edu)

IceTray Release v1.7.0

  • Make I3Tray.I3Tray and icecube.icetray.I3Tray the same thing. (#3102)

Jul. 27, 2022 don la dieu (nega AT icecube.umd.edu)

IceTray Release v1.4.0

  • Drop support for Python 2

  • Clean up pybindings

Dec. 21, 2021 Kevin Meagher (kmeagher AT icecube.wisc.edu)

IceTray Release V01-03-00

  • minor fixupts to test_run_examples.py

  • add fake pybindings target to workaround weirdness in CommonVariable’s pybindings

  • Documentation fixes

Dec. 20, 2019 Alex Olivas (aolivas@umd.edu)

Combo Release V00-00-00

June 12, 2018 Kevin Meagher

V00-04-02

  • Add documentation for TrackHitsDistributionSmoothness and TrackHitsSeparationLength

  • Use direct_hits.get_default_definitions() function rather than global variable

  • Script Cleanup (remove Finish() and TrashCan

March 24, 2017 Anna Pollmann (anna.pollmann@uni-wuppertal.de)

Release V00-04-01

  • Switch all projects to using our own serialization library

  • python3 fixup

  • added StdDevDomDistQTotDom variable

    – Alex Burgman

March 24, 2017 Anna Pollmann (anna.pollmann@uni-wuppertal.de)

Release V00-04-00

  • added the TimeCharacteristics Module incl. a bunch of new tested variables

    – Anna Pollmann

  • class definition and converters moved to recclasses

April 3, 2015 Meike de With (meike.de.with@desy.de)

Release V00-03-02

  • Recognize I3_TESTDATA

    – Alex Olivas

December 9, 2014 Meike de With (meike.de.with@desy.de)

Release V00-03-01

  • Use right number of backslashes in latex math environments for documentation, to avoid problems with older matplotlib versions

    – Martin Wolf

  • Import DomTools instead of MuonVariables (for I3FirstPulsifier)

    – Meike de With

September 11, 2014 Meike de With (meike.de.with@desy.de)

Release V00-03-00

  • Added steamshovel artists

  • Replace relative Python imports, which are not support by old Python versions

    – Martin Wolf

  • Include standard integers

    – Don la Dieu

January 15, 2014 Meike de With (meike.de.with@desy.de)

Release V00-02-02

  • Use log4cplus tool when available (for backward compatibility)

  • Small fix in documentation

    – Martin Wolf

  • Make project compatible with Python 3

    – Nathan Whitehorn

August 20, 2013 Meike de With (meike.de.with@desy.de)

Release V00-02-01

  • Make project compatible with Python 3

    – Nathan Whitehorn

  • Added math documentation about the actual implementation of the AvgDomDistQTotDom and EmptyHitsTrackLength cut variables of the track_characteristics sub project

    – Martin Wolf

February 21, 2013 Emanuel Jacobi (emanuel.jacobi@desy.de)

Release V00-02-00

  • Changed ZTravel calculation to take only the time of the first pulse per DOM

  • Changed track_hits_separation_length calculation to take the time of the first pulse and the integrated charge of a DOM to determine the COG quartiles to not introduce data/MC discrepancies due to the NPulses issue.

  • Call the Configure method of the I3ConditionalModule class, so the If module parameter does not get ignored.

  • Make sure that CV does not cut on the given I3RecoPulseSeriesMaps based on the given Geometry.

  • Improved documentation

    – Martin Wolf

  • Simplify the nPulses computation

    – David Boersma

  • Removed dependency on log4cplus

    – Nathan Whitehorn

  • Add svn keywords

    – Emanuel Jacobi

September 26, 2012, Emanuel Jacobi (emanuel.jacobi@desy.de)

Release V00-01-00

Initial release. Copied from http://code.icecube.wisc.edu/svn/sandbox/mwolf/i3projects/CommonVariables